An adaptation is a change in structure or behavior that helps a living thing survive in its environment. It enhances the organism's ability to thrive and reproduce in its surroundings, increasing its chances of survival. Adaptations can result from genetic changes over time or through learning and behavioral modifications.

Some examples of gregarious animals include wolves, meerkats, and elephants. Their social behavior benefits their survival in the wild by allowing them to work together to find food, protect each other from predators, and care for their young. By living in groups, these animals can share resources, communicate effectively, and increase their chances of survival.
